Required Skills Strong experience facilitating workshops and information-gathering sessions Expertise in documenting business processes and requirements using BPMN or similar notation Proficiency in developing functional and non-functional requirements Handson experience with Jira or similar backlog management tools Strong analytical, problemsolving, and communication skills Experience working in healthcare-related projects or similar domains Ability to translate business requirements into user stories and manage them in Jira Experience documenting asis and tobe processes, gap analysis, and creating training/reference documentation Experience grooming and prioritizing backlogs and managing iterative development Overview The Senior Business Analyst will serve as a bridge between business and technology teams to identify business needs and document them for use in developing a Lung and HPV Screening Solution. This position involves gathering and analyzing requirements, facilitating workshops, documenting workflows and business processes, and managing user stories. The role requires strong analytical, communication, and facilitation skills, as well as experience working on healthcarerelated projects. Job Responsibilities Facilitate workshops and informationgathering sessions; create supporting materials such as presentations, agendas, and meeting minutes Document current (asis) and future (tobe) business processes and standard operating procedures using BPMN or similar tools Gather and document functional and nonfunctional business requirements, perform gap analyses, and develop user stories/use cases Translate business requirements into user stories and manage them using Jira or similar tools Create documentation to support training activities, including reference guides and other instructional materials Document operational frameworks to support ongoing program delivery Facilitate iterative development and manage changing requirements while collaborating with crossfunctional teams Create and manage user stories, epics, and tasks, ensuring clear and traceable requirements throughout the development lifecycle Groom and prioritize backlogs using Jira based on business value, stakeholder input, and technical feasibility Perform other related duties as assigned Only those lawfully authorized to work in the designated country associated with the position will be considered.
